Abstract
본 발명은 농업분야, 환경분야, 식품분야, 양어장, 가축의 음용수처리 등의 분야에 이용 할 수 있는 유용미생물의 배양방법을 제시하는 것이 목적이다.An object of the present invention is to provide a method for culturing useful microorganisms that can be used in fields such as agriculture, environment, food, fish farming, and drinking water treatment of livestock.
이를 위하여 본 발명은, 미생물배양조(1)에 부식물질 펠렛트(Pellet)와 미네랄(Minerals)용출이 용이한 광물 및 원적외선이나 음이온을 방사하는 광물(3) 등을 충전(充墳)한 생물반응기(Bio-reactor ; 2)를 설치하고, 배양액과 종균을 주입하고 미생물배양조(1)와 생물반응기(2)에 공기를 공급하여 폭기를 하면 배양액은 생물반응기(2)의 부식물질 펠렛트와 광물(3)의 충전층을 순환하면서 미생물생육에 필요한 미네랄 및 활성효소성분 등을 공급받아 활성화된 미생물을 배양하며, 이때 보다 활성화된 미생물을 배양하기 위해서 미생물배양조(1)의 배양액을 자속밀도(磁束密度)가 10,000가우스(Gauss)이상 착자된 영구자석이나 전자석(5)의 자계(磁界) 및 자화된 자철광(8)이 충전된 자화탱크(7)을 순환시킨다.To this end, the present invention is a microbial culture tank (1) filled with a corrosive pellet (Pellet) and minerals (Minerals) easy to dissolve minerals and minerals (3) that emits far infrared rays or anions (등) When a reactor (Bio-reactor; 2) is installed, the culture medium and the seed are injected, air is supplied to the microbial culture tank (1) and the bioreactor (2), and the aeration is carried out. The culture medium is a pellet of the corrosive material of the bioreactor (2). And circulating the packed bed of minerals (3) to receive the minerals and active enzyme components necessary for the growth of microorganisms and to cultivate the activated microorganisms, in which case the culture medium of the microorganism culture tank (1) in order to cultivate the activated microorganisms The magnetization tank 7 filled with the magnetic field and the magnetized magnetite 8 of the permanent magnet or electromagnet 5 magnetized with a density of 10,000 Gauss or more is circulated.
그리고, 배양규모가 큰 경우에는 도2에서와 같이 배양액을 저장하였다가 사용하는 경우에는 배양액 저장조(9)의 미생물의 활성도를 유지시키기 위해서는 광물(3)이 충전된 미네랄 용출이 용이한 광물 및 원적외선이나 음이온을 방사하는 광물(11)이 충전된 미네랄반응기(10)를 설치하여 공기를 주입하여 폭기를 한다.In the case where the culture size is large, the culture solution is stored as shown in FIG. 2, and when the culture solution is used, in order to maintain the activity of the microorganisms in the culture medium storage tank 9, minerals and minerals easily filled with minerals 3 are easily released. In addition, a mineral reactor 10 filled with minerals 11 emitting negative ions is installed to inject air to aeration.

본 발명은 부식물질 펠렛트(Pellet)와 미네랄 용출이 용이한 광물 및 원적외선이나 음이온을 방사하는 광물과 자석 및 자철광() 등을 이용하여 농업분야, 환경분야, 식품분야, 양어장, 가축의 음용수처리 등에 이용 할 수 있는 유용 미생물의 배양방법을 제시하는 것이 목적이다.The present invention is a pellet (Pellet) and minerals that are easy to dissolve minerals and minerals and magnets and magnetite that emits far infrared rays or anions ( The purpose of the present invention is to propose a method of cultivating useful microorganisms that can be used for agriculture, environment, food, fish farming, drinking water treatment of livestock.
일본 특허공보 평(平)5-66199호에서는 유기성물질을 함유한 폐수처리에서 일반활성오니처리공정에서 부식토를 펠렛트(Pellet)형태로 가공한 것과 미네랄 용출이 용이한 유문암(流紋岩) 또는 대사이드(Dacite)질의 부석(浮石)을 충전한 생물반응기가 내장된 배양조를 설치하여 침전조에서 폭기조로 반송하는 종오니의 일부를 배양조로 보내어 활성화된 균주를 배양하여 폭기조로 보내어 처리한 결과 일반활성오니처리공정에 비해서 처리효율이 상당히 향상되는 효과가 있었으나 전술한 부식토 및 부석 중에서 자철광함량이 낮거나 자화도가 낮은 경우에는 처리효율이 크게 향상되지 않은 문제점이 있었다.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 5-66199 discloses the processing of humus soil into pellets in the general activated sludge treatment process in wastewater treatment containing organic substances, and in the case of rhyolite rock which is easy to dissolve minerals or As a result of installing a culture tank with a bioreactor filled with a crust (Dacite), a part of the sludge returned from the sedimentation tank to the aeration tank was sent to the culture tank, and the activated strain was cultured and sent to the aeration tank. Compared to the activated sludge treatment process, the treatment efficiency was significantly improved. However, when the magnetite content was low or the degree of magnetization was low among the humus and pumice, the treatment efficiency was not significantly improved.
본 발명은 상기와 같은 문제점을 해소하기 위해 농업분야, 환경분야, 식품분야, 양어장, 가축의 음용수처리 등에 이용 할 수 있는 유용미생물의 배양방법을 제공하는 데 본 발명의 목적이 있는 것이다.An object of the present invention is to provide a method for cultivating useful microorganisms that can be used in agriculture, environmental, food, fish farms, drinking water treatment of livestock in order to solve the above problems.
이와 같은 목적을 달성하기 위한 본 발명은, 자화된 자철광, 자석, 부식물질, 미네랄 용출이 용이한 광물, 원적외선이나 음이온을 방사하는 광물 등을 이용하여 활성화된 유용미생물을 배양하는 방법을 제시한다.The present invention for achieving the above object, a method for culturing the activated useful microorganisms using magnetized magnetite, magnets, corrosive substances, minerals that are easy to dissolve minerals, minerals that emit far infrared rays or anions.

이하 도면을 중심으로 본 발명의 내용을 상세히 설명하면 다음과 같다.Hereinafter, the contents of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the drawings.
생물학적 악취처리의 경우에는 흡수탑의 순환용액을 배양액으로 사용하며, 양어장의 수처리 경우에는 양어장내의 물을 배양액으로 사용하고, 하 ·폐수의 생물학처리의 경우에는 침전조에 침전된 오니를 폭기조로 반송하는 종오니의 일부를배양액 및 종균으로 사용하여 풀브산(Fulvic acid) 함량이 많은 부식물질을 펠렛트(Pellet) 형태로 가공한 것과 미네랄(Minerals) 용출이 용이한 감람석(橄欖石), 각섬석(角閃石), 흑운모(黑雲母), 진주석(珠石), 흑요석(黑曜石), 송지석(松脂石), 유문암(流紋石)이나 대사이드(Dacite)질의 부석(浮石)과 같은 광물을 1종류이상 충전(充墳)하고, 원적외선(遠赤外線)이나 음이온을 방사하는 천매석(千枚石), 맥반석(飯石), 전기석(電氣石), 거정석(巨晶石), 의왕석(王石), 석영섬록암(石英閃綠岩), 귀보석(貴石), 태징석(泰石), 신명석(神明石)과 같은 광물도 1종류이상 충전한 생물반응기(Bio-reactor ; 2)가 내장된 미생물반응조(1)에 공급하면서 송풍기로부터 공기를 공급하여 폭기를 하면 배양액은 생물반응기(2)에 충전된 부식물질 펠렛트 및 광물(3)의 층을 순환하면서 킬레이트(Chelate)성 착염상태의 미네랄(Minerals) 성분과 활성효소 등을 공급받아 미생물은 활발한 대사활동을 하는 상태로 배양된다.In the case of biological odor treatment, the circulating solution of the absorption tower is used as a culture solution.In the case of water treatment of fish farms, water in the fish farm is used as a culture solution.In the case of biological treatment of sewage and wastewater, sludge deposited in the sedimentation tank is returned to the aeration tank. Part of the sludge was used as a culture medium and spawn to process corrosive materials with a high content of Fulvic acid in the form of pellets, and olivine and hornblende, which are easy to dissolve minerals. Stone, biotite, mother-of-pearl One or more kinds of minerals, such as stone, obsidian, songji stone, rhyolite, and diaphragm, are filled with one or more kinds of minerals. Aphrodisiac, anemone stone, and elvan Stone, tourmaline, giant stone, Uiwang stone 王石, Quartz diorite, precious stones 石, Tajing Stone If aeration is supplied by supplying air from the blower while supplying a microbial reactor (1) with a built-in bioreactor (2) filled with one or more kinds of minerals such as stone and shinmyeongseok, 2) Microorganisms are cultured with active metabolic activity by supplying chelating complex minerals and active enzymes while circulating the corrosive pellets and layers of minerals (3). .
이때 보다 활성화된 미생물을 배양하기 위해서는 순환펌프(Pump ; 4)의 토출측에 자속밀도(磁束密度)가 10,000가우스(Gauss)이상 착자된 영구자석이나 전자석(5)을 설치하고, 자화탱크(Tank ; 7)에는 자속밀도가 200가우스이상 착자된 자철광(8)을 충전한 자계(磁界)를 순환하여 자화처리를 한다.At this time, in order to culture more activated microorganisms, a permanent magnet or an electromagnet 5 magnetized with a magnetic flux density of 10,000 Gauss or more on the discharge side of a circulating pump 4 is installed, and a magnetization tank (Tank; 7) magnetizes by circulating a magnetic field filled with magnetite 8 magnetized with a magnetic flux density of 200 gauss or more.
물(유체)이 자석(5)과 자성을 띈 자철광(8)의 자계를 통과하게 되면 자기유체역학(MHD ; Magneto-Hydro-Dynamics)전압이 발생하면서 전자의 파동(波動)에 의해서 물분자의 집단체(集團; Cluster)가 미세화(微細化)되면서 표면장력(表面張力)이 적어져 침투력(浸透力)이 향상되어 용해력이 향상되면서 탈취효율도 향상되고, 미생물의 세포막 투과율이 향상되어 미생물의 대사활동을 활발하게 한다.When water (fluid) passes through the magnetic field of the magnet 5 and the magnetized magnetite 8, the magneto-hydro-dynamics (MHD) voltage is generated and the wave of the electrons Collective ; As the cluster becomes finer, the surface tension decreases, the penetration force is improved, solubility is improved, deodorization efficiency is improved, and cell membrane permeability of microorganism is improved, so that metabolic activity of the microorganism is increased actively. do.
그리고, 필요에 따라서는 미생물생육의 최적의 조건으로 pH 및 산화환원전위(ORP ; Oxidation Reduction Potential)값을 조정한다.And, if necessary, the pH and Oxidation Reduction Potential (ORP) values are adjusted to optimal conditions for microbial growth.
가축의 음용수에 유용미생물배양액을 혼합하여 급여하는 경우나 식품공장에서 유용미생물배양액을 사용하는 경우에는 바칠루스 마이코이데스(Bacillus mycoides), 바칠루스 서브틸리스(Bacillus subtillis), 바칠루스 나토(Bacillus natto), 아스페르길루스 니거(Aspergillus niger), 페니실리움 글로쿰(Penicillum glaucum), 소랑세루로섬(Sorangium cellulosum), 악티노마이세스 그로비오 포러스 로세어스(Actinomyces globioporus roseus), 슈도모나스속(Pseudomonas sp.), 사상균, 방선균, 유산발효균과 같은 필요한 유용미생물의 종균을 초기에는 접종하고, 배양액은 당밀, 한천, 수용성전분, 육즙과 같은 유기물에 키토산(Chitosan)을 첨가한 배양액을 사용하고, pH의 조정은 목초산, 구연산, 주석산과 같은 각종 미네랄성분과 착염을 생성할 수 있는 유기산(有機酸)을 사용하여 부식물질을 펠렛트와 전술한 광물(3)을 충전한 생물반응기(2)가 내장된 미생물반응조(1)에 공급하면서 송풍기로부터 공기를 공급하여 폭기를 하면 배양액은 생물반응기(2)에 충전된 부식물질 펠렛트 및 광물(3)의 층을 순환하면서 킬레이트성 착염상태의 미네랄성분과 활성효소 등을 공급받아 미생물은 활발한 대사활동을 하는 상태로 배양되며, 이때도 보다 활성화된 미생물을 배양하기 위해서는 순환펌프(4)의 토출측에 자속밀도가 10,000가우스이상 착자된 영구자석이나 전자석(5)을 설치하고, 자화탱크(7)에는 자속밀도가 200가우스이상 착자된 자철광(8)을 충전한 자계를 순환하여 자화처리를 한다.Bacillus mycoides, Bacillus subtillis, Bacillus natto, when a mixed microbial medium is fed to drinking water of livestock, or when a useful microbial medium is used in a food factory. natto, Aspergillus niger, Penicillum glaucum, Sour Initially inoculate the seed of necessary useful microorganisms, such as Sorangium cellulosum, Actinomyces globioporus roseus, Pseudomonas sp. The culture solution is a culture solution in which chitosan is added to organic matters such as molasses, agar, water-soluble starch and gravy, and the pH is adjusted to organic acids that can form complex salts with various mineral components such as acetic acid, citric acid and tartaric acid. Iv) by supplying air from the blower while supplying the corrosive material to the microbial reactor (1) in which the bioreactor (2) filled with the pellet and the mineral (3) described above is aerated. 2) Microorganisms are active in metabolic activity by supplying chelating complex minerals and active enzymes while circulating the corrosive pellets and the layers of minerals (3). In order to cultivate more activated microorganisms, a permanent magnet or an electromagnet (5) magnetized with a magnetic flux density of 10,000 gauss or more is installed on the discharge side of the circulation pump (4), and the magnetic flux density is provided in the magnetization tank (7). The magnetization process is performed by circulating a magnetic field filled with magnetite 8 magnetized at least 200 gauss.
그리고, 배양미생물을 저장하였다가 사용하는 경우에는 도2에서와 같이 배양액 저장조(9)를 설치하고, 배양액 저장조(9)에서 미생물의 활성도를 유지하기 위해서 전술한 미네랄 용출이 용이한 광물과 원적외선이나 음이온을 방사하는 광물(11)을 충전한 미네랄공급기(10)을 설치하여 송풍기로부터 공기를 공급하여 폭기를 하면 배양액이 미네랄공급기(10)에 충전된 광물(11)의 층을 순환하면서, 순환펌프(4)로는 영구자석이나 전자석(5)과 자화탱크(7)의 자철광(8)의 자계를 순환하여 자화처리를 하므로서 미생물은 활발한 대사활동을 하는 상태로 활성이 유지되도록 한다.In addition, in the case of storing and using the cultured microorganism, as shown in FIG. 2, a culture medium storage tank 9 is provided, and in order to maintain the activity of the microorganisms in the culture medium storage tank 9, the above-mentioned minerals and far-infrared minerals are easy to dissolve. When the mineral feeder 10 filled with the minerals 11 emitting negative ions is installed to supply air from the blower, the aeration is circulated while circulating the layers of the minerals 11 filled in the mineral feeder 10. (4) by circulating the magnetic field of the permanent magnet or electromagnet (5) and the magnetite (8) of the magnetization tank (7) to the magnetization process to keep the activity in the state of active metabolic activity.
이상에서 전술한 바와 같이 본 발명에서는 생물학적악취처리, 하 ·폐수의 생물학처리, 양어장, 가축의 음용수, 식품공장 등에서 유용미생물배양의 경우 활성도가 높은 미생물이 배양되기 때문에 이들 분야에 널리 이용될 것으로 전망된다.As described above, the present invention is expected to be widely used in these fields because microorganisms having high activity are cultivated in the case of useful microbial culture in biological malodor treatment, biological treatment of sewage and wastewater, fish farms, drinking water of livestock, food factories, etc. do.
